"Avoid in warm weather"
First, the good points. The room was clean, the staff were friendly, and the food was plentiful at breakfast time.
The bad points: we stayed during a heatwave and the lack of ventilation or air conditioning made this absolutely stifling hot even at night. The hotel provided a desk fan and we opened the window but it was still 27 degrees in the room overnight which made for pretty terrible sleep. This really needs updating to air conditioning to be suitable for any season other than winter.
The restaurant seemed to be understaffed which meant delays getting served and some of the things we ordered for breakfast never materialised. I'm used to buffet breakfast when the hotel is busy but they were cooking to order which I'm sure added to the staffing issues.
All in all, if I was in this part of the world in the depths of winter I'd risk staying here again but otherwise I'd give it a miss
